ONE OF THE TYPICAL APPLICATIONS OF LAPLACE TRANSFORMS is the solution of nonhomogeneous linear constant coefficient differential equations. In the following examples we will show how this works. The general idea is that one transforms the equation for an unknown function \(y(t)\) into an algebraic equation for its transform, \(Y(t)\) .The Laplace transform calculator transforms the equation from a differential equation to an algebraic equation (without derivative), where the new independent variable ss is the frequency. Take the Laplace Transform of the differential equation; Use the formula learned in this section to turn all Laplace equations into the form L{y}. (Convert all things like L{y''}, or L{y'}) Plug in the initial conditions: y(0), y'(0) = ? Rearrange your equation to isolate L{y} equated to something. The Laplace transform is capable of transforming a linear differential equation into an algebraic equation. Linear differential equations are extremely prevalent in real-world applications and often arise from problems in electrical engineering, control systems, and physics.

Let's try to fill in our Laplace transform table a little bit more. And a good place to start is just to write our definition of the Laplace transform. The Laplace transform of some function f of t is equal to the integral from 0 to infinity, of e to the minus st, times our function, f of t dt. That's our definition. It's a property of Laplace transform that solves differential equations without using integration,called"Laplace transform of derivatives". Laplace transform of derivatives: {f' (t)}= S* L {f (t)}-f (0). This property converts derivatives into just function of f (S),that can be seen from eq. above.
